Inflammation, as an essential part of the healing process, is initiated by the body due to an injury or infection. However, it can sometimes turn into chronic inflammation which increases the risk of various health problems. Conversely, taking regular natural anti-inflammatory foods in your diet enables you to curb this risk. These foods have an abundance of antioxidants, omega-3 fatty acids and other bioactive substances that can be attributed to the healthcare properties as anti-inflammation.

 

A variety of fruit and vegetable as well as nuts and seeds that in their whole form are an aid to combat the inflammation is the beauty of whole food. Such awareness surrounding the impact these foods make on health and incorporating them into regular meals are therefore recommended as they promote better health and longevity and in the end, conditions with chronic inflammation may be reduced. Fruits - Nature's Anti-Inflammatory Powerhouses

Fruits do not give an answer only when it is tasty but also they are a sign of fighting inflammation.

 

Berries

Little wonders like strawberries, blueberries and raspberries are alive with antioxidants, the redeeming agents of which are anthocyanins. Due to the very nature of these components, berries display magnificent color and possess very strong anti-inflammatory abilities. Studies of “anthocyanins” have shown them to be powerful compounds that reduce inflammation markers. Therefore, including berries in an anti-inflammatory diet is highly recommended.

 

Cherries

When wanting to eat something sweet, cherries, whether be sweet or sour, offer more than simple sweetness. Anthocyanins and cyanidin which in turn are known for inflammatory modulating effects are inherent in them. These components may play a role in addressing inflammation or perhaps even lower and gout, a form of inflammatory arthritis. Introducing cherries as part of nutritional input to your diet might offer a refreshing means for removing inflammation without prescriptions.

 

Pineapple

Pineapple is not only a treat but also a natural super-anti-inflammatory, because it fights inflammation at the cellular level. The fruit is high in an enzyme; bromelain which is research backed and has strong anti-inflammatory properties. Bromelain helps in reduction of swelling and cuts down the incidence of inflammation, hence, assists in healing of the involved area.

 

Vegetables- Nature's Anti-Inflammatory Champions

Making efficient use of colorful vegetables in your diet is the most important antidote to inflammation. This is the safest way to a healthy life. Here are some standout vegetables and their anti-inflammatory benefits:

 

Leafy Greens

Among the sources of green vegetables such as spinach, kale, and Swiss chard are nutritional superstars which provide you with vital v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. These vegetables, however, stand out in the richest array of vitamins A, C, and K, as well as folate with fiber. In inclusion of antioxidants in the leafy greens such as flavonoids and carotenoids the inflammation and oxidative stress of the body is abated. Eating at least one section of green vegetables like leafy greens to your daily meal can help alleviate systemic inflammation.

Broccoli

Broccoli, also well known as a storehouse of many health gains, is not an exception having anti-inflammatory features. A benefit of Brussels sprouts that may surprise you is that they contain sulforaphane, which is an anti-inflammatory compound that is quite strong. Sulforaphane acts as an inhibitor of the inflammatory process, by decreasing the production of inflammatory enzymes and cytokines.

 

Bell Peppers

Red, orange, yellow, green and every color of peppers is not only appealing but the culinary delights (both) as well as bursts with nutrients that can reduce inflammation and promote general wellbeing. These vibrant vegetables, rich in quercetin, a flavonoid which exacerbates inflammation, are beneficial for health. Quercetin has been known to show a potent anti-inflammatory activity through suppressing the release of inflammatory mediators in the body. You can enhance the flavor and the added anti-inflammatory values to your diet by including bell peppers in your meals.

 

Nuts And Seeds - Vital Little Engines Of Anti-Inflammatory Lifeblood

Nuts and seeds not only make their way into our checked list of healthy snack options but also provide us with a more specific nutritional diversity with fighting inflammation. Here are some noteworthy nuts and seeds and their anti-inflammatory benefits:

 

Walnuts

Walnut becomes the ALA omega-3 fatty acid's major source by providing it with ALA. Not only is Omega-3 fatty acid known for its powerful anti-inflammatory capacity, but they also provide help during the inflammatory process. In addition, the polyphenols these walnuts contain add to the anti-oxidants which make the anti-inflammatory effects even more potent. Include walnuts in your diet in sufficient amounts regularly because it is savory and very convenient to keep body inflammation at bay with this method.

 

Flaxseeds

Flaxseeds are also an alternative/additional source of ALA, a fatty acid type that is typically referred to as omega-3 and is associated with anti-inflammatory benefits. We have found out that flaxseeds could successfully reduce dangerous markers of inflammation within a body so you can add them to your preventive anti-inflammatory diet. Besides all it contains fibers and lignans which are the compounds that aid in buildings overall health and wellness.

 

Chia Seeds

Chia seeds are tiniest but mightiest nutrition packing balls having its rifled with omega-3 fatty acids, antioxidants, and fibrous. The omega-3 fatty acids present in chia seeds (including ALA) perform functions, such as fighting inflammation and protecting your heart from diseases. To complete its profile of anti-inflammatory components, chia will contribute quercetin, a very powerful antioxidant, and chlorogenic acid.

 

Fatty Fish - Superfoods Armed With The Omega-3 Sting For Fighting With Inflammation

The fats in fatty fish are rich in omega-3 fatty acids which mainly consist of EPA and DHA. However, the two omega-3 fatty acids have demonstrated powerful anti-inflammatory properties. Here are two standout fatty fish and their anti-inflammatory benefits:

 

Salmon

Salmon is amongst the most renowned sources of omega-3 fatty acids, hence the superstar of this cause as inflammation-fighting is concerned. EPA and DHA, the two effectual omega-3 fatty acids in the salmon species, are well-known for their contributions to anti-inflammatory processes throughout your body. These fatty acids can stop the making of proinflammatory molecules and bring about the synthesis of anti-inflammatory compounds.

 

Sardines

Sardines are the other rich sources that possess omega-3 fats and also virtual D as an advantage. Omega-3 fats, especially EPA and DHA, have been extensively studied on their capability in inhibiting inflammatory responses. Concurrently, vitamin D influences immunity and can be responsible for lowering the inflammation in the body as well.
